Dominical Letter - Examples

Examples

  • 2001 G
  • 2002 F
  • 2003 E
  • 2004 DC
  • 2005 B
  • 2006 A
  • 2007 G
  • 2008 FE
  • 2009 D
  • 2010 C
  • 2011 B
  • 2012 AG
  • 2013 F
  • 2014 E
  • 2015 D
  • 2016 CB
  • 2017 A
  • 2018 G
  • 2019 F
  • 2020 ED

The dominical letter of a year determines the days of week in its calendar:

  • A common year starting on Sunday
  • B common year starting on Saturday
  • C common year starting on Friday
  • D common year starting on Thursday
  • E common year starting on Wednesday
  • F common year starting on Tuesday
  • G common year starting on Monday
  • AG leap year starting on Sunday
  • BA leap year starting on Saturday
  • CB leap year starting on Friday
  • DC leap year starting on Thursday
  • ED leap year starting on Wednesday
  • FE leap year starting on Tuesday
  • GF leap year starting on Monday
